N.C. Gen. Stat. § 90-113.73A

Expand monitoring capacity; report

(1) The North Carolina Controlled Substances Reporting System shall expand its monitoring capacity by establishing data use agreements with the Prescription Behavior Surveillance System. In order to participate, the CSRS shall establish a data use agreement with the Center of Excellence at Brandeis University no later than January 1, 2016.

(2) Repealed by Session Laws 2020-78, s. 4B.1(a), effective July 1, 2020.

History
(2015-241, s. 12F.16(j), (k); 2020-78, s. 4B.1(a).)
